Teams go through stages of development. During the stage called ________, group structure solidifies and the group is assimilati

ng a common set of expectations of what defines correct member behavior.
Health
1 answer:
denis-greek [22]3 years ago
8 0

Answer:

Norming

Explanation:

The norming stage of group development is a stage of development of bonds and group identity. It is in this stage that the group develops a sense of synergy and the structure of the group solidifies. When members are in the norming stage of development, they have a feeling of togetherness and have a common set of expectations and feeling that they can accomplish more as a group than individually.
